Object Avoidance

The most effective robot vacuums come with object avoidance. This helps the appliance navigate around furniture leg and other toys. This feature is crucial for families with pets and children, as the yeedi robot vacuum can be damaged or jammed in the event of hitting them.

The system is usually built around a single pair of sensors located near the vacuum's shock-absorbing bumpers. When sensors detect a roadblock the robot will change direction and turn until it locates an open path. Some models use lidar technology, which makes use of lasers for measuring the distance between the robots and other objects. This allows the robot to create a live map of its surroundings, and helps it move through your living space with more effectiveness.

Other robovacs that do not employ lidar technology are designed to make use of binocular or monocular vision to detect obstacles with cameras. These systems are most efficient in bright lighting however they don't perform better in low light or with objects that have the same color as the surrounding environment. For instance, a robot with monocular vision might have trouble recognising shoes or cables.

Floor Mapping

Most robot vacuums come with sensors that can detect objects. If a object -- like furniture legs or a randomly toy that is thrown around gets in the way the sensor will trigger that tells the vacuum to steer away from the obstacle and to move towards a cleaner section of the floor. These sensors aren't foolproof. The Roomba 900 Series, for example, was able to stay clear of our shoeslaces and headphones but it did end up sucking into a cable. This is why we recommend putting objects out of the 360 robot vacuum's path prior to running it through your home's rooms.

Mopping Settings

Robot vacuums operate on autopilot and require nothing more than hitting the button on a remote or in an app to have them clean a room. You can also set schedules with voice commands. This is a fantastic feature for robotic shark vacuum busy families who want their robot automatic vacuum robot cleaners to complete their chores at the exact time each day.

Many robot mops feature microfibre pads, which are hydrated by water tanks located at the base. They can be used for a number of times before they need to be replaced or washed. Look for models that can alter the amount of water dispensed to fit different flooring types. Also, you should consider the dimensions of the tank, whether you can change the cleaning mode between dry and wet mopping, and how long a robotic mop can last on one charge.
